Top 5 Air Travel Apps on iOS in Portugal Q4 2021
Explore the performance trends of the top 5 air travel apps on iOS in Portugal during Q4 2021, including downloads, revenue, and active users.
In Q4 2021, the top 5 air travel apps on iOS in Portugal showcased varying tr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. These insights come from Sensor Tower, providing a detailed look at the performance of each app.
Ryanair saw a steady increase in we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$23 in the final week of December. Weekly downloads fluctuated, reaching a high of 2K in early October and a low of 1.1K in late December. Active users experienced a slight decline, starting at 6.9K in late September and ending at 6.6K by the end of the quarter.
easyJet: Travel App did not generate any revenue during this period. Weekly downloads remained relatively stable, with a peak of 907 at the end of September and a low of 564 in early December. Active users varied slightly, starting at 5.5K in late September and ending at 5.3K in late December.
TAP Air Portugal also reported no revenue. Weekly downloads saw minor fluctuations, peaking at 850 in mid-October and dropping to 553 in early November. Active users showed a slight downward trend, starting at 1.7K in late September and ending at 1.4K by the end of December.
Flightradar24 | Flight Tracker experienced significant revenue peaks, with the highest being $546 in mid-October. Downloads were relatively consistent, with a noticeable spike to 855 in mid-December. Active users increased from 3.8K in late September to 4.2K by the end of December.
Planes Live - Flight Tracker had a consistent revenue stream, peaking at $464 in late September and maintaining around $400 towards the end of December. Downloads varied, reaching a high of 695 in late September and a low of 344 in early November. Active users started at 1.4K in late September and ended at 1.1K by the end of December.
